I had a consultation with Director Jang Cheol-ho. He isn’t exactly the friendly type. The consultation lasted a little over 5 minutes, and seeing that the consultant said she was surprised because he normally doesn’t consult for this long, I think I felt that way because he’s the type to only talk about the main points.

When I showed him photos of the celebrity eyes I wanted, he didn’t say he would match them as much as possible, but firmly said they didn’t suit me at all. He recommended keeping the line as it is while slightly lifting only the end, and procedures suited to my eyes, such as ptosis correction or fat grafting.

I’m getting revision surgery because I want glamorous eyes, so I’m debating because he said it wouldn’t work. But I’ve heard that the director developed a method related to under-eye fat repositioning and is known to be good at lowering eyelid lines, so I don’t doubt his skill, but I’m worried my aesthetic satisfaction will be low.

The wait was about 30 minutes because a surgery ran long. The price seems to be in the mid-to-high range. The consultant was just businesslike, not unfriendly, and didn’t pressure me to book. Since the A/S is for 3 years, I think I’ll worry less even if it loosens. I’m going to put down a deposit and think it over.
